Been a while since I've posted an update around here.

This is what we've been up to:


Gigging - we've played a few live shows with more on the way, including a very sucessful show with A23. The shows have been received well and we hope to do more soon.

recording - We've got a title and a lot of the next full-length album done. We hope to release "A Million Different Moments" by the end of the year. It's shaping up to be even more ambitious than "Sublimation." Additionally we've collected some odds and ends and remixes and such and should be releasing the "Footfalls EP" Real Soon Now. This will most likely be free for download or physically purchase-able for a small fee.

Merch - "Sublimation" is now popping up in a bunch of new stores, including the US "Best Buy" chain. And we now have some new merch to sell, too - specifically Tshirts and pins. Tshirts are black, and are $10+SH. Pins are $1 + SH but there's a much more limited quantity of those (but they give you great emo cred, right? right?)

Website redesign - New back-end, new server, new technology, new look, RSS syndication of news, more content, more stuff for gearheads, trainspotters and anoraks...and it validates to XHTML 1.0 so it's web-standards compliant - browse nulldevice.com from your wap phone with no trouble at all!

remixing - we've got two, count 'em two, remixes on the new Epsilon Minus limited edition of "Mark II." The second one is unusual for both Null Device and Epsilon Minus. Additionally we've got a remix on the upcoming US release of the new Distorted Reality album "The Fine Line Between Love and Hate."

Videos - Eric Goedken has shot and assembled a great set of videos that accompany the live show, as well as some new videos for songs off Sublimation. The video for "The Sad Truth" should be appearing on an upcoming video compilation, and we just finished shooting a video for "Sacre Coeur." These videos will appear on the website as they are completed. "Word and Deed" and "Sad Truth" are there now.
